Job Description

Schedule: Monday - Friday first shift (8-4/9-5) (rotating half day Saturdays)

Start Rate: $15.50

Essential functions of this job include but are not limited to:

  • Learns new tasks remembers processes maintains focus completes tasks independently makes timely decisions in the contexts of workflows and is able to complete tasks that have a speed and/or productivity quota.
  • Effectively implements Agency and program policies and procedures.
  • Secures facility keys in designated area at all times.
  • Documents via zoom chat that their shift has started and they have reviewed all relevant documentation from prior staff. At the conclusion of their shift documents via zoom chat that they are logging off and have made sure all program activities emergency situations and unusual incidents are communicated to the next shift.
  • Reads all staff meeting minutes if not in attendance for actual meeting and documents in an email or zoom chat that it was completed.
  • Checks all perimeter doors at the end of each work shift to ensure they are locked and alarms are armed. Records results of check on shift report each shift.
  • Documents unusual activity vandalism maintenance issues injuries and medical concerns as needed. Notifies appropriate supervisor as necessary.
  • Effectively communicates emergency situations in a timely manner to Operations Supervisor Program Administrator EM Director or designee as required.
  • Effectively communicates emergency situations in a timely manner to co-workers and a facility supervisor as required. Completes required documentation in an accurate and timely manner.
  • Notifies a facility supervisor immediately when law enforcement and/or fire department/EMS personnel are called to the facility.
  • Notifies a facility supervisor when law enforcement agencies call the facility requesting client information.
  • Maintains accurate and timely whereabouts of all clients assigned to the program. Calls clients to verify whereabouts. Notifies appropriate facilities and outside agencies of any unauthorized client activities.

QUALIFICATIONS: High School diploma or equivalent required. Associates Degree in human services field preferred. Relevant job experience may be substituted for preferred college degree. An aptitude with current technology preferred. Must possess a valid Ohio drivers license reliable transportation and a driving record that does not preclude the employee from being covered by Agency liability insurance. Must possess exceptional clerical office organizational and prioritizations skills. Must have the cognitive skills needed to complete tasks including abilities such as learning remembering focusing categorizing and integrating information for decision making problem solving and comprehending. Must have the ability to simultaneously address multiple complex problems and multi-task without loss of efficiency or accuracy. Must be able to perform effectively and efficiently under high stress emergencies and conflict situations. Must have the ability to effectively work with Agency employees outside contacts and a diverse client population.
